Job Title: Curriculum Developer (Junior Level)

About the Role

We are seeking a motivated Junior Curriculum Developer to support the design and development of engaging, technically sound training materials for IT learning programs. This is an entry-level role ideal for individuals passionate about education, technology, and instructional design.

Experience

  • 0–2 years of experience in instructional design, curriculum development, or technical writing (internship or academic experience acceptable)

Key Responsibilities

  • Assist in designing and developing training modules for IT courses (e.g., software development, cloud, cybersecurity, data science)

  • Research and curate content under the guidance of senior team members

  • Develop slide decks, handouts, quizzes, and lab activities based on instructional objectives

  • Support the update of course materials in response to feedback or technology updates

  • Collaborate with subject matter experts (SMEs) and instructional designers to align content with learning outcomes

Education

  • Bachelor’s degree in Education, Instructional Design,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field

Skills & Tools

  • Basic knowledge of IT concepts (programming, networking, cloud, etc.)

  • Proficiency in MS Office or Google Workspace

  • Exposure to authoring tools (Articulate, Rise, Adobe Captivate, etc.) is a plus

  • Strong written communication and organization skills

  • Eagerness to learn instructional design principles and adult learning theory
